So far I am very happy with the vibe. The baby seat is a tight squeeze in the back, but I came up with a solution for that. So far the mods include tint, Magnaflow Cat-Back, and roof spoiler. I do miss some of the features of the Blazer, and the ability to go anywhere. The interior on the Vibe feels cheap, even with the Leather. The stereo sounds great for factory components. Congrats on the baby. By coincidence, I traded in a 2002 black blazer ZR2 in April for a new 07 Vibe. My reasons were because the extended warranty was about to expire, and because I was getting around 16.5 MPG combined city and Hwy. I drive 50 miles round trip to work everyday so it was getting pretty expensive. So far I love the Vibe, but there are times I miss sitting up real high and that feeling like you can plow through anything, but getting double the MPG makes up for a lot of that.
